    I think you can be a gay Christian. The Biblical injunctions about being gay have mostly to do with dominance, temple prostitution, pederasty, lust, and inhospitability. The idea of a loving same sex relationship was unknown in biblical culture.

    Actually at 1 Corinthians 6:9-10 there is a simple list of those who will not inherit God’s kingdom. Listed is "men who lie with men", there is no mention of "lust, domination, pederasty, gang rape, or temple prostitution", it merely lists "men who lie with men" among others who will not inherit God’s kingdom.
